Packetlabs is a cybersecurity consulting firm specializing in Advanced Penetration Testing.

We offer several services, including infrastructure Penetration Testing, Web & Mobile Application Testing, Social Engineering, Red Team exercises, Source-code Reviews and Exploit Development.

Our clients occupy several industries, including but not limited to:
government, technology, law enforcement, retail, healthcare and financial.


Our slogan, "Ready for more than a VA scan?" illustrates our commitment to the industry to provide only expert-level penetration testing.

The minimum qualification on our team is the OSCP and most of our team has well beyond that.

Packetlabs' Ethical Hacking team thinks outside of the box, finds weaknesses others overlook, and continuously learns new ways to evade controls in modern networks.
